# Atom-One-Dracula Theme

A custom Visual Studio Code theme that combines the Atom One Dark theme with Dracula Soft syntax highlighting, created by [Austin Spraggins](https://github.com/spragginsdesigns).

## Introduction

Atom-One-Dracula is a Visual Studio Code theme that blends the sleek, dark aesthetics of the Atom One Dark theme with the vibrant, high-contrast syntax highlighting of the Dracula Soft theme. This theme aims to provide a visually appealing and easy-to-read coding environment.

## Installation

To install the Atom-One-Dracula theme in Visual Studio Code, follow these steps:

1. **Download the Theme Files**: Download the `one-dark-dracula.json` and `package.json` files from this repository.

2. **Create the Theme Directory**: Navigate to your VS Code extensions folder:
```
C:\Users\Owner\.vscode\extensions
```

3. **Add the Theme Files**: Create a new folder named `one-dark-dracula-theme` and place the downloaded `one-dark-dracula.json` and `package.json` files inside this folder.

4. **Reload VS Code**: Press `Ctrl+Shift+P` (or `Cmd+Shift+P` on macOS) to open the Command Palette and type `Developer: Reload Window` to reload VS Code.

## Usage

After reloading VS Code, you can activate the Atom-One-Dracula theme:

1. **Open the Command Palette**: Press `Ctrl+Shift+P` (or `Cmd+Shift+P` on macOS) to open the Command Palette.
2. **Select Color Theme**: Type `Preferences: Color Theme` and press Enter.
3. **Choose One Dark Dracula**: Select `One Dark Dracula` from the list of available themes.

## Customization

You can further customize the theme by editing the `one-dark-dracula.json` file. This file defines the color scheme and styles for various UI elements and syntax highlighting.

### Example Customization

To change the background color of the editor, modify the `editor.background` property in `one-dark-dracula.json`:

```json
{
"colors": {
"editor.background": "#1e1e1e",
...
},
...
}
```

After making changes, reload VS Code to apply the new settings.
